按键精灵,调用子程序后,怎么返回主程序?

按键精灵,调用子程序后,怎么返回主程序?,第1张

1、首先新建一个按键精灵脚本,方法很简单。我就不给大家演示了。下图是我打开的按键精灵脚本。

2、首先在按键精灵中源文件的输入界面中输入子程序:Sub dzh()End Sub。

3、在子程序里面输入一个打招呼的命令:MessageBox "你好啊?"。

4、然后在第4行输入调用子程序命令:Call dzh()。

5、单击调试,我们看一下效果。(在这里启动程序的快捷键是F10)。

6、按下启动键自动d出子程序里面打招呼的内容。

1 子程序完成后,需要通过RET指令返回到调用该子程序的主程序中。

2 RET指令会将子程序的返回地址d出堆栈,并跳转到该地址执行主程序。

3 在主程序中,可以继续执行下一条指令,完成整个程序的执行。

i = 0

j = 0

While true

While i <30

Call A()

i = i + 1

j = j + 1

If j >= 2000 Then

Call B()

j = 0

End If

Wend

KeyPress 115, 1

Delay 1000

i = 0

Wend

Sub A()

KeyPress 112,1

Delay 1000

KeyPress 113,1

Delay 1000

LeftClick 1

Delay 1000

End Sub

Sub B()

KeyPress 120,1

Delay 1000

LeftClick 1

Delay 1000

End Sub

按键9写的,应该就是这样了吧,有问题我再改


欢迎分享,转载请注明来源:内存溢出

原文地址: https://www.outofmemory.cn/yw/11259780.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2023-05-14
下一篇 2023-05-14

发表评论

登录后才能评论

评论列表(0条)

保存